To simplify the given exponential expression, we will use the definition of a zero exponent.

Zero Exponents

a^0=1, for every nonzero number a

We will also use the definition of a negative exponent.

Negative Exponents

a^(- n)=1/a^n, for every nonzero number a

Let's evaluate the given expression using these definitions.
4^(- 3)* 4^0
4^(- 3)* 1
4^(- 3)
1/4^3
1/64
